Baycadd Solutions Inc.

200-1296 carling ave K1Z7K8 Ottawa Ontario Canada
  • Profile: Baycadd Solutions Inc. is a Engineering, Accounting, Research, Management & R company located at Ottawa, Ontario Canada, address is 200-1296 carling ave, Ottawa K1Z7K8 ON, postcode is K1Z7K8, you can contact Baycadd Solutions Inc. by phone 6137617175
Please share as much information as you can about Baycadd Solutions Inc. so other users can benefit from your comment.